Atlético de Madrid and Fanatics, the global leader in licensed sports merchandise, announced on Wednesday the renewal until 2025 of their e-commerce and manufacturing deal. The new deal will see Fanatics retain global e-commerce and manufacturing rights for our team, ensuring that the club's fans will have access to one of the largest ranges of merchandise in the world through our official online store at atleticodemadridstore.com´

Fanatics, which partners with more than 300 of the biggest sports clubs and organizations worldwide, will exclusively operate the global e-commerce business for our club. In 2020 alone Fanatics delivered merchandise to Atlético fans in 96 different countries.

In continuing their partnership with Fanatics, one of the most innovative companies in the world, Atlético de Madrid will utilize cutting edge e-commerce systems and the company’s vertical commerce model, which combines on-demand manufacturing with an agile supply chain to produce the timeliest assortments of merchandise for fans. Fanatics’ global network, which is now based out of eleven countries worldwide ensures that Atlético fans will be able to show their support for the team wherever they are based.

Iñigo Aznar, CCO of Atlético de Madrid, said: "We are eager to continue our ecommerce partnership with Fanatics through until 2025, a partnership which is now even more strategic.


“During these last years, Fanatics allowed us to reach our fans globally and improve their shopping experience. Likewise, the partnership enables us to boost the international business reaching new markets, which already represent more than 60% of all sales. The outlook is that it will continue to rise in the coming years."


The Club will also utilize Fanatics’ industry leading Cloud Commerce technology which provides rapid navigation for fans across online and mobile sites. This will mean faster website performance, larger hi-resolution product displays, local languages and currencies and frictionless checkout, transforming the online shopping experience for Atlético fans.

Zohar Ravid, General Manager for Fanatics’ International Business and based at the organization’s Spanish Head Office in Barcelona, said: “Atlético de Madrid is one of the biggest and most successful teams in European football. They are admired across the world for their spirit and passion and we are excited to continue our partnership with them, growing their business and serving their fans both in Madrid and across the world.

“Our cloud commerce system will give Atlético fans an unrivalled experience online, ensuring that they have a much quicker and easier time selecting and buying their merchandise, no matter how strong the demand. We will help the Club to benefit from the significant investment we make in technology each year, the learnings we collect from the hundreds of partners on our platform and the truly global access, ensuring all fans across the world are able to access merchandise using their locally preferred language and currency.”

Fanatics partners with several of the biggest football clubs across Europe and some of the largest sporting organizations in the world, including NFL, NBA, MLB, NHL, England Rugby and Formula One.

ABOUT FANATICS

As the global leader in licensed sports merchandise, Fanatics is changing the way fans purchase their favorite team apparel and jerseys through an innovative, tech-infused approach to making and selling fan gear in today's on-demand culture, including manufacturing and distributing all Nike NFL and MLB jerseys and fan apparel sold at retail. Operating multi-channel commerce for the world's biggest sports brands in every major geography in the world - be that the USA, Asia-Pacific, Europe or South America - Fanatics offers the largest collection of timeless and timely merchandise whether shopping online, on your phone, in stores, in stadiums or on-site at the world's biggest sporting events.

As multi-channel company, Fanatics operates more than 300 online and offline stores, including the e-commerce business for all major professional sports leagues (NFL, MLB, NBA, NHL, NASCAR, MLS, PGA), and more than 200 collegiate and professional team properties, which include several of the biggest global soccer clubs (Paris Saint-Germain, Manchester United, Chelsea, Bayern Munich). The company's in-venue and event retail portfolio includes the FA Wembley Store, England Rugby Twickenham Store and NBA & NHL flagship stores in New York City along with in-arena stores for dozens of European football, NFL, NBA, MLB, NHL teams and numerous college teams.
